Native Installation

Developers should use native installation when building or deploying applications that need maximum performance, low latency, or direct access to hardware features, such as gaming engines, scientific computing tools, or system-level software

Pros

  • +It is also essential for development environments where tools like compilers, debuggers, or IDEs must interact closely with the operating system, ensuring compatibility and reducing overhead compared to virtualized setups
